Colorado Springs area has many holiday tea options
With all the rush, rush of the festive season, what better way to take a breather than with a cup of tea? Why not make it a pot? You can do just that at several locations where holiday teas are being offered. Reservations required. Here’s a look at a few:
– Cherokee Ranch & Castle, 6113 N. Daniels Park Road, Sedalia, offers holiday tea at 1 p.m. Tuesdays through Fridays and 2 p.m. Saturdays. Closed Dec. 22 and 24 to 28. Cost is $50 per person. Details: 303-688-5555, cherokeeranch.org.
– Glen Eyrie Castle, 3820 N. 30th St., offers the Yule Tea at 11 a.m. and 2:30 p.m., (check website for dates). For $29 per person tea is served in the Music Room, which is a smaller dining room where you get an appetizer, entrée, sweets and a selection of teas. For $34 per person you can enjoy tea in the Great Hall, which is a larger space where entertainment is included. Details: 265-7050, gleneyrie.org.
– The Margarita at PineCreek, 7350 Pine Creek Road, has its holiday tea 11:30 a.m. to 2:30 p.m. Dec. 19. For $27 per person you get a selection of teas, savory bites and homemade pastries. Details: 598-8667, online at margaritaatpinecreek.com.
– Miramont Castle Museum, 9 Capitol Hill Ave., Manitou Springs, in the Queen’s Parlour Tearoom 11 a.m. to 3 p.m. Wednesdays through Sundays, you can have a four-course tea ($35 per person), or light Victorian three-course tea ($26 per person). Details: 884-4109, miramont castle.org.
– Wisdom Tea House, 65 Second St., Monument, offers its Holiday Tea 2 p.m. Tuesdays through Saturdays for ages 10 and older. For $30 per person you get an assortment of savory and sweet treats. Details: 481-8822, wisdomteahouse.com.

Michael Paradiso, culinary arts department chair at Pikes Peak Community College, with his culinary students has created the Gingerbread Village. The musical display is on the second level of Chapel Hills Mall at the Dillard’s entrance until Dec. 13.

Enoteca Rustica, 2527 W. Colorado Ave., is located upstairs from Pizzeria Rustica. “Enoteca Rustica,” according to the Pizzeria Rustica’s newsletter, means wine bar (or store) in Italian. It’s a small space that seats about 44 people and will be a wine bar, cocktail bar, craft beer bar, antipasti bar and dessert room. Hours are 4 to 10 p.m. Fridays and Saturdays in December.

New takeout bakery
The Cañon City Queen Anne Gourmet Bakery, 813 Macon Ave., Cañon City, is an online service. Visit thecanoncity queenanne.com to find a link to an order form and selections that are available. Orders are taken Tuesday through Thursday for pickups prior to 10 a.m. on the following Friday or Saturday. The menu includes heart-shaped cinnamon roll dessert, giant pecan sticky buns, scones, chocolate chip pecan cookies, mini bundt cakes, pies, German kuchen butter pecan coffee cake and brownies.
